IMA erp
Tartalomjegyzék
Az IMA integráció a QUiCK és az IMA könyvelőprogram között létesít közvetlen, kétirányú adatkapcsolatot. Az ügyfél a QUiCK-ben iktat, kategorizál, címkéz, követi a likviditást és a havi eredményt; a könyvelő az IMA-ban végzi az ügyviteli könyvelést, ÁFA-bevallást és főkönyvi feladásokat. Eddig a két rendszert manuális adatátvitel kötötte össze: exportált fájlok, beolvasott számlaképek, kétszer rögzített tételek. Az integráció ezt felszámolja. A QUiCK-be érkező számlák adatai és képei automatikusan átáramlanak az IMA-ba, a könyvelő pedig az ottani munkafolyamatban dolgozik tovább velük – nem egy közös felületen, hanem egy közös ütőéren keresztül.
Cél és kontextus
A QUiCK és az IMA két különböző logikájú rendszer. A QUiCK pénzügyi kontrolling és számlaiktatási platform: a számlák bejövetelét, OCR-feldolgozását, NAV-párosítását, kategorizálását, likviditástervezését és a havi eredmény vizualizációját végzi. Az IMA ügyviteli könyvelőrendszer: főkönyvi könyvelés, áfa-bevallás, bérszámfejtés, beszámolók és NAV-feladások készülnek benne. A két rendszer ugyanazokat a számlákat látja – csak más szögből.
Az integráció célja, hogy a QUiCK-ben rögzített számlaadatok és képek könyvelői beavatkozás nélkül kerüljenek át az IMA-ba, miközben a könyvelő által karbantartott metaadatok (főkönyvi szám, költséghely, munkaszám, IMA címke) az ÁFA, költségtípus, bevételtípus és címke összerendelésein keresztül automatikusan ráhúzódnak az átemelt számlákra. A folyamat háttérben fut, négy óránként szinkronizál, és lehetővé teszi, hogy a könyvelő az IMA-ban dolgozzon, az ügyfél pedig a QUiCK-ben – ugyanazon a számlán, ugyanannál az adatpontnál.
A funkció elsősorban azoknak a könyvelőirodáknak és vállalkozásoknak hasznos, ahol a könyvelő IMA-t használ, az ügyfél pedig QUiCK-en keresztül iktat. A kapcsolat egyszer kerül felépítésre, ezután önállóan dolgozik.
Hol található?
Az integráció két oldalon konfigurálható, és a két oldal együtt alkotja a teljes kapcsolatot:
QUiCK oldalon: Profilbeállítások → Integrációk és eszközök → API Tokenek – itt generálható az az API kulcs, amellyel az IMA azonosítja magát a QUiCK API-ja felé. A token egyszer jeleníthető meg (létrehozáskor), tárolása a könyvelő/integrátor felelőssége.
IMA oldalon: Számla rögzítés → Külső interface beállítások → Quick fül – itt található az API kulcs beillesztése, az import- és fájlkezelési beállítások, az automatizmus opciók, valamint az ÁFA-, költségtípus-, bevételtípus- és címke-összerendelések. Az utolsó 5 API esemény státusza (success/error) ugyanitt, az Infó aloldalon ellenőrizhető.
A két felület egymásra mutat: a QUiCK-ben generált token nélkül az IMA-oldali beállítások nem indíthatók el; az IMA-oldali összerendelések nélkül a QUiCK-ből érkező számlák nem kerülnek értelmezésre az IMA számviteli logikájában.
Előfeltételek
A teljes integráció működéséhez az alábbi feltételeknek kell teljesülniük:
IMA verzió: Az IMA – QUiCK teljes integráció az IMA v 3.123.805-ös verziójától elérhető. A korábbi 3.123.795 / 3.123.800 verziókban a Quick interface kizárólag a számlaképek automatikus átemelését végzi el azoknál a számláknál, amelyeket a QUiCK-ben könyveltre (azaz Quick által feldolgozottra) állítottak. A nem könyveltre állított számlák a 800-as verzióban semmilyen formában nem jelennek meg az IMA-ban.
QUiCK API kulcs: Profilbeállítások → API Tokenek → Új Token létrehozása – elnevezhető szabadon (pl. „IMA"), tárolása biztonságos helyen szükséges.
Cégegyezőség: A QUiCK-ben iktató cég és az IMA-ban kezelt cég számviteli értelemben ugyanaz az entitás kell legyen. Több cég esetén cégenként külön API token és külön IMA-oldali konfiguráció szükséges.
„Quick által feldolgozottra állítva" státusz aktiválása (opcionális, alapértelmezett mód): Ez a státusz a QUiCK-en belül könyvelői hozzáféréshez kötött, és aktiválásához ügyfélszolgálati kérés szükséges. Csak ezután állítható egy számla erre a státuszra, és csak ezután fog megjelenni az IMA importjában a default beállítás mellett.
ÁFA hozzárendelés: Az import folyamat szempontjából kritikus – ÁFA-mapping nélkül az IMA nem tudja értelmezni a QUiCK ÁFA-kódjait, így a számlák nem fognak helyesen átfutni.
A működés (pontosan, lépésről lépésre)
1. Mit szinkronizál az integráció?
A QUiCK – IMA kapcsolat hat különálló adatfolyamot kezel, amelyek függetlenül kapcsolhatók be vagy hagyhatók ki:
Adatfolyam | Irány | Gyakoriság |
Szállítói számlaképek | QUiCK → IMA | Folyamatos, NAV/igény státuszú számlához rendelve |
Vevői számlaképek | QUiCK → IMA | Folyamatos, NAV/igény státuszú számlához rendelve |
Szállítói számlaadatok | QUiCK → IMA háttér állomány | 4 óránként automatikus |
Vevői számlaadatok | QUiCK → IMA háttér állomány | 4 óránként automatikus |
Költségtípus / bevételtípus / címke metaadatok | QUiCK → IMA összerendelés | Számlaérkezéskor |
Főkönyv | IMA → QUiCK | Beállítás-alapú, opcionális |
Külön említést érdemel két tesztelés alatt álló funkció: a szállítói és vevői számlák átvétele 4 óránként közvetlenül igény státuszba (a manuális import felület kihagyásával). Ez nem minden IMA-példányban élesedett még; a könyvelővel egyeztetve aktiválható, ha rendelkezésre áll.
2. A számlakép-átvétel logikája
A számlakép automatikus átemelése három különböző állapot mentén dönt:
A számla már rögzítve van az IMA-ban, igény státuszban → a Quick interface a számlaképet az igény státuszú számlához rendeli. Ez az alapeset.
A számla már rögzítve van az IMA-ban, véglegesített státuszban → a rendszer nem rendel számlaképet hozzá. Az alapfeltevés az, hogy véglegesítés csak számlakép birtokában történik. (Ezen később egy IMA-beállítás módosítani fog tudni.)
A számla még nincs rögzítve az IMA-ban → a rendszer megnézi a NAV szállítói/vevői számlák listáját, és ha ott találja a számlát, oda rendeli a számlaképet.
A logika szállítói és vevői oldalon azonos elven működik.
3. Beállítási sorrend (javasolt)
A QUiCK-IMA integráció felépítése négy lépésre bontható, és pontosan ebben a sorrendben érdemes haladni:
A. API kulcs létrehozása és beillesztése
QUiCK oldalon: Profilbeállítások → Integrációk és eszközök → API Tokenek → Új Token létrehozása. A megjelenő tokent egyszer látod, így rögtön másold át.
IMA oldalon: Számla rögzítés → Külső interface beállítások → Quick fül → Beállítások aloldal → Quick API kulcs mező. Az IMA elmaszkolja a tokent; megjelenítéséhez a szem ikont kell használni. Beállítások mentése gombbal véglegesíthető.
A sikeres kapcsolatot az Infó fülön az utolsó 5 API esemény success státusza igazolja.
B. Import beállítások
A Beállítások aloldal Import beállítások blokkjában:
Főkönyv szinkronizálás – Igen esetén az IMA főkönyve automatikusan átkerül a QUiCK-be, és az IMA főkönyvi struktúrája lesz az irányadó. Nem esetén nincs főkönyvi szinkron.
Áthozandó számlák státusza – két opció:
Quick által feldolgozottra állítva (alapértelmezett): csak azok a számlák jelennek meg az IMA-ban, amelyeket a QUiCK-ben kifejezetten könyvelésre adtak át. Az aktiváláshoz a QUiCK ügyfélszolgálatát kell megkeresni, és a könyvelőnek hozzáféréssel kell rendelkeznie.
Nincs státusz, azonnal a QUiCK-be kerüléskor: minden új QUiCK-be érkező számla bekerül a 4 óránként futó automatikus szinkronba.
Átvétel kezdő ÁFA teljesítési dátuma – a rendszer csak az ennél a dátumnál újabb ÁFA-teljesítéshez tartozó számlákat hozza át. Hasznos rendszerbevezetéskor, hogy a régi tételek ne zúduljanak rá az IMA-ra.
C. Fájlkezelési és automatizmus beállítások
Import ideiglenes állomány megőrzési ideje (napokban) – ennyi idő után az IMA automatikusan törli azokat a számlaadatokat, amelyek átvételre nem kerültek (pl. duplikált, irreleváns tételek), hogy ne foglalják a tárterületet.
Vevői / szállítói számlák direkt beszúrása igény státuszú számlaként – jelenleg tesztelés alatt álló funkció, élesedés után automatikusan kihagyja a manuális import felületet, és a számla – ha minden szükséges paraméter rendelkezésre áll – azonnal igény státuszba kerül.
D. Összerendelések finomhangolása
Az integráció üzemszerű működése közben az alábbi listák dinamikusan bővülnek: ahogy érkeznek a számlák, a Quick interface új ÁFA-sorokat, költségtípusokat, bevételtípusokat és címkéket emel be. Ezek mindegyikét egyenként vagy tömegesen kell az IMA megfelelő logikai egységéhez rendelni:
ÁFA hozzárendelés (kötelező az import előtt) – külön szállítói és külön vevői blokk. Az Új áfa összerendelése ikonnal a QUiCK-ből érkező ÁFA-sor egy IMA-oldali ÁFA-kódhoz rendelhető. Színkódok: halványzöld = párosítva, rózsaszín = automatizmusból kizárt, egyéb = nincs párosítva.
Költségtípus átforgatása – a QUiCK költségtípusához hozzárendelhető: munkaszám, költséghely, szállítói könyvelési csoport, IMA címke, ellen főkönyvi szám. Ezek közül egyszerre több is kiválasztható.
Bevételtípus átforgatása – ugyanazokkal a paraméterekkel, mint a költségtípus.
Címke átforgatása – hozzárendelhető: munkaszám, költséghely, IMA címke, ellen főkönyvi szám (szállítói könyvelési csoport itt nem). Több paraméter is kiválasztható egyszerre.
A négy összerendelési típus erő sorrendje rögzített és nem módosítható:
ÁFA hozzárendelés
Költségtípus
Bevételtípus
Címke
A rendszer az első beállított megfelelésnél megáll – a sorrendben hátrébb lévő beállításokat nem veszi figyelembe. Ez fontos tervezési szempont: ha például egy számla költségtípusához tartozó költséghely ütközik a címkéhez beállított költséghellyel, a költségtípusé fog érvényesülni.
4. Csoportos szerkesztés
Az összerendelések tömegesen is kezelhetők, az alábbi öt lépésben:
A módosítani kívánt sorok kijelölése
Tömeges kezelés gombra kattintás
A módosítandó mező kiválasztása (munkaszám / költséghely / címke levél / ellen főkönyvi szám)
Az új érték megadása
OK gombbal megerősítés
Ez különösen induláskor hasznos, amikor egyszerre több tucat új sor kerül be az IMA-ba.
Mikor hasznos és kinek?
Az IMA integráció a QUiCK–IMA tandem alaplogikájára épülő funkció: ahol a két rendszer együtt van használatban, ott szinte mindig kifizetődik a beállítás. Különösen értékes:
IMA-t használó könyvelőirodáknak, akiknek QUiCK-es ügyfélportfóliójuk van. A számlák képei, ÁFA-jai és tipizált adatai automatikusan az IMA-ba érkeznek, így a könyvelő az ismerős felületén dolgozik tovább, kézi átvitel nélkül.
QUiCK-es vállalkozásoknak, akiknek IMA-s könyvelője van. Az ügyfél nem foglalkozik azzal, hogyan kerül át az anyag a könyvelőhöz – elegendő a QUiCK-ben tartani a folyamatot rendben.
Bevezetési projekteknél, ahol egyszerre kerül átállítás az iktatás (QUiCK) és a könyvelési oldal (IMA). Az integráció innentől magától hidalja át a két rendszert, így a folyamatos áttranzakcióra nem kell külön figyelni.
Vegyes csapatoknak, ahol van belső pénzügyes (QUiCK-ben dolgozik) és külső könyvelő (IMA-ban dolgozik). Az integráció a kettejük közötti munkamegosztást egy közös ütőérre cseréli.
Pro tipp: Az integráció bevezetése előtt érdemes az ÁFA hozzárendelés blokkját kiindulási adatokkal feltölteni – akár tesztkörnyezetben végigfuttatott szinkronból. A teljes ÁFA-mapping előzetes elkészítése drasztikusan csökkenti az első éles import során szükséges manuális beavatkozást.
Specialitások és limitációk
A használat során az alábbi sajátosságokra érdemes figyelni:
Nem real-time: A számlaadatok és metaadatok átvétele 4 óránként fut. Sürgős átvitelre az integráció nem alkalmas; aki azonnali eredményt vár, az a manuális Számla import menüpontot használhatja az IMA-oldalon, ahol a már átvett háttér állományból azonnal feldolgozható a számla.
Az IMA verziójához kötött funkcionalitás: Az IMA v 3.123.795 / 800 csak számlakép-átvételt támogat (és ott is kizárólag a könyveltre állított számlák esetén). A teljes integráció a 3.123.805-ös vagy újabb verziótól érhető el. Frissítés nélkül a meta-adatok és a státuszok nem áramlanak át.
Tesztelés alatt álló funkciók: A számlák automatikus, 4 óránkénti igény státuszba helyezése (manuális import kihagyásával) jelenleg nem minden IMA-példányban élesedett. Aktiválás előtt érdemes az IMA-ügyfélszolgálatnál ellenőrizni az érintett cégen.
Véglegesített számlához nem rendel képet: A jelenlegi logika nem írja felül a már véglegesített IMA-számla képét. Ezen későbbi IMA-verzió beállíthatóvá teszi, de jelenleg ez fix viselkedés.
Az API token egyszer jelenik meg: Létrehozáskor látszik, utána az IMA elmaszkolja. Elvesztés esetén új tokent kell generálni a QUiCK-ben, és a régit törölni.
API kapcsolat ellenőrzése: Hibás token vagy elcsúszott jogosultság esetén az IMA Infó fülén error státuszú események jelennek meg, jellemzően a következő üzenettel: „Quick import exception: QUICK auth hiba (403). Ellenőrizd a sett1_quick_api_key-t és a kimenő Authorization / X-Api-Key headereket." Az üzenetek a QUiCK API-tól érkeznek, az IMA azokat változatlanul jeleníti meg.
Az erő sorrend nem módosítható: ÁFA → költségtípus → bevételtípus → címke. Ha egy adott paraméter (pl. költséghely) több helyen is be van állítva, csak az első találat érvényesül. Ez a tervezést egyértelműsíti, de figyelmet igényel: ütközés esetén a hátrébb lévő beállítás némán „nem fog működni".
Sztornó és módosító számlák: A NAV XML-ben jelölt sztornó és módosító számlák különálló rekordként kerülnek át az IMA-ba, ugyanazon szabályok szerint, mint a normál számlák.
Devizaeltérés: Ha a QUiCK-ben és az IMA-ban a számla devizája nem egyezik, a bruttó érték mező üres marad, a többi mező felülíródik a NAV-adat szerint.
„Áthozandó számlák státusza" alapértéke előfizetéshez kötött: A Quick által feldolgozottra állítva alapbeállítás aktiválásához könyvelői hozzáféréssel rendelkező felhasználó és ügyfélszolgálati kérelem is szükséges. Aki ezt nem aktiválja, az a Nincs státusz opcióval tud csak dolgozni – ami mindent áthúz az IMA-ba a 4 órás ciklusban.
Az import ideiglenes állomány automatikusan törlődik: A megadott napok után az IMA törli a könyvelés szempontjából nem releváns vagy duplikált rekordokat. A számlák így nem maradnak fent „örökre" az ideiglenes állományban; ez a tárhellyel és a tisztasággal kapcsolatos automatizmus.
A QUiCK-en belüli adatváltozások utánkövetése: Ha egy QUiCK-ben rögzített számla utólag módosul (kategória, ÁFA, partner, összeg), a változás a következő 4 órás szinkronban kerül át az IMA-ba. Több gyors egymás utáni módosítás esetén csak az utolsó verzió fog átmenni.